Abstract:
The Bates, Dewey mss., 1888-1889, consists of correspondence primarily between artist Dewey Bates, 1851-1898; his wife, Kate, 1860-1948; and his brother, Stockton, 1843-1916, president of the Bridesburg Manufacturing Company.

Biographical / Historical:

Dewey Bates, 1851-1898, was born in Philadelphia, Pennsylvania, on November 22, 1851, to Leone Calendar, 1818-1899, and stockbroker David Bates, 1809-1870. His older brother Stockton, 1843-1916, later became the president of Bridesburg Manufacturing Company. Bates became interested in art as a child, and studied art in Europe after graduating from high school in 1870. He established himself as an artist in London in the 1870s and married Londoner Kate Mary Feetum, 1860-1948, in 1887. Bates only returned to the United States twice: in 1888, to paint a portrait of his former classmate, Pennsylvania governor Robert Emory Pattison, 1850-1904, and in 1896, to present an exhibition of his work at the Art Club of Philadelphia. He died in Hastings, England, in July 1898.

Scope and Content:

This collection consists of 13 complete letters (signed by Dewey Bates), 2 large letter fragments, and group of smaller fragments. Also included are 8 letters from his wife, Kate, written during his illness and subsequent death. There is also one letter from R. W. Scott, a friend. All letters in this collection were written to Bate's brother, Stockton.

Bates' letters concern his work and poverty. Kate's letters describe his suffering in his last months and the circumstances of his death. She occasionally refers to him by his nickname, "Drop" (believed to be a play on the "dew" in his name).
